description:
Avoid some dynamic scope stupidity in interpreted code, #'notany, #'notevery.

2010-12-29  Aidan Kehoe  <kehoea at parhasard.net>

	* cl-extra.el (notany, notevery): Avoid some dynamic scope
	stupidity with local variable names in these functions, when they
	weren't prefixed with cl-; go into some more detail in the doc
	strings.
